1990 Chevrolet Blazer vs. 1979 Toyota Carina

To start off, 1990 Chevrolet Blazer is newer by 11 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1979 Toyota Carina.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1979 Toyota Carina would be higher. At 2,471 cc (4 cylinders), 1990 Chevrolet Blazer is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1990 Chevrolet Blazer weights approximately 435 kg more than 1979 Toyota Carina.

Because 1990 Chevrolet Blazer is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1979 Toyota Carina.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1990 Chevrolet Blazer will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
